Mini-Circuits SMT MMIC, Low Noise, Medium Power, Linear, Dual Matched, pHEMT Amplifier, 40 MHz to 3000 MHz, 50Ω, QFN Style Package MPGA-105+

Description
MPGA-105+ is a dual matched wideband amplifier fabricated using advanced E-PHEMT technology, offering high dynamic range (High IP3 and Low NF) for use in 50 and 75 ohm applications. This model has demonstrated exceptionally high IP2 in wideband 50 and 75 ohm amplifier evaluation boards. Combining this performance with low noise figure makes it suitable for use in very high dynamic range amplifiers.
